Ashurst, Perkins Coie Guide Rockhopper's $200M Equity Raise

Global law firm Ashurst Perkins Coie is advising longstanding client Rockhopper Exploration plc, the oil and gas company with key interests in the North Falkland Basin, on its up to US$200 million capital raising.

The capital raising comprises an approximately US$180 million placing and an up to US$20 million open offer, the net proceeds of which are expected to be used by Rockhopper to fund certain of its business activities in the Falkland Islands.

The Ashurst Perkins Coie team is being led by partners Harry Thimont and Julia Derrick, with support from senior associates Louise Johnson and Maria McAlister, associates Aoife Weir, Victoria Kirk and Marisa Muramatsu and trainee Harry Sun. Partner Jeffrey Johnson is advising on US securities matters.
